Explore a groundbreaking framework for flexible and granular multi-user access control in shared Internet of Things (IoT) environments. Delve into FLUID-IoT, a system that transforms existing IoT apps into centralized hubs capable of selectively distributing UI components based on user permission levels. Learn about the framework's performance evaluation, covering aspects such as coverage, latency, and memory consumption, and discover how it seamlessly integrates with existing IoT platforms. Gain insights from an in-lab user study demonstrating the intuitive and user-friendly nature of FLUID-IoT, requiring minimal training for efficient utilization. This 15-minute conference talk, presented at CHI 2024: The ACM CHI Conference on Human Factors in Computing Systems, addresses the growing demand for sharing IoT devices among multiple users and offers a solution to the limitations of current IoT platforms' all-or-nothing approach to access control.
